I am an Arizona state certified teacher but when my niece who is WAY behind came to live with me I decided that the best "fit" was AZVA. I have really been impressed, but it is NOT for parents that do not want to be active in their child's education. The K-12 curriculum is really challenging and can be expanded to meet those kids who are gifted or down-scaled easily for special needs students. She has only been in the program since January and has moved forward about 3/4 of a year in that amount of time.

As a parent you do also need to make sure that your child gets the socialization that they are missing in school. Thanks to the programs through parks and rec, that part is easy.

I know my niece LOVES being able to do school work in her pajamas on occassion and likes being able to take field trips more often than once a year.

Cost to parents, by the way, is zero for AZVA....they cover everything from books to the computer!
